Broadridge Launches Agentic AI Platform

⦿ Executive Snapshot
- What: Broadridge Financial Solutions has launched an agentic AI platform to enhance capital markets and wealth management operations.
- Who: Broadridge Financial Solutions, Tom Carey (President of Broadridge’s Global Technology & Operations).
- Why it matters: The deployment is expected to reduce operational costs by up to 30% and marks a significant advancement in the integration of AI in financial services.
⦿ Key Developments
- Broadridge’s AI agents autonomously analyze, prioritize, and resolve operational exceptions without continuous human oversight.
- The AI platform can be accessed through a fully managed service or as a standalone solution integrating with clients' existing infrastructure via open-standard APIs.
- The platform is built on the financial industry’s first completed data ontology, leveraging over 60 years of operational data and $15 trillion in daily trading activity.
- Live capabilities include automated trade fails management, account opening workflows, real-time valuation exception handling, and customer inquiry automation.
- The workflows operate within a human-supervised architecture to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ements.
⦿ Strategic Context
- The launch of Broadridge’s AI platform reflects a broader trend in the financial sector towards automation and operational efficiency through advanced technology.
- Historically, the financial industry has relied on fragmented point solutions, and Broadridge's integrated platform aims to address this gap by offering a more cohesive operational model.
⦿ Strategic Implications
- The immediate consequence may be a competitive advantage for firms that adopt Broadridge’s integrated AI solutions, potentially reshaping market dynamics in capital markets and wealth management.
- Long-term, the success of this platform could drive widespread adoption of AI technologies across the financial services industry, influencing future operational strategies.
⦿ Risks & Constraints
- Potential risks include regulatory challenges as firms navigate compliance with AI-driven operations in a highly regulated environment.
- Competition from other technology providers could impact Broadridge’s market share and adoption rates of its AI platform.
⦿ Watchlist / Forward Signals
- Future developments to watch include client uptake rates of the AI platform and any new capabilities that Broadridge may announce.
- The effectiveness of the platform in reducing operational costs and its ability to comply with regulatory standards will signal its long-term success or failure.
